The 2017 Valmaggiore is characterized by a nose of red fruits with licorice and cola. The wine is delicate and shows great typicity of the vine. In the mouth there is an initial burst of sweetness framed around the expressive red fruit.
Excellent tannin and acidity help balance the vibrant and ripe red fruit flavors of cherries and cranberries. This is a generous open and sweet expression of the Valmaggiore. The finish is balanced and ripe ending with a distinct mineral note.
